Minimum Bank Balance For Canada Student Visa
The actual amount necessary may vary depending on the length of your study program, your location in Canada, and whether you have dependents with you. For the most current and up-to-date information, check the Immigration, Refugees, and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) website or the Canadian embassy or consulate in your home country.
The needed bank balance for a Canada visa varies depending on the kind of visa and period of stay. To get a visiting visa, you must demonstrate that you have adequate finances to maintain your stay. For student visas, the Canadian government typically needs confirmation of CAD 10,000 plus tuition fees for a year outside of Quebec, and CAD 11,000 plus tuition in Quebec.
The money you need to provide as a bank statement requirement for a Canadian student visa must come from the following sources: personal income, business income, personal assets, and investment Income.
Study Permit For Student Visa
A study permit is a document that authorizes foreign nationals to study at designated learning institutions (DLIs) in Canada. Most foreign nationals require a study permit to study in Canada. Make sure you have all of the necessary paperwork before applying. You should apply before travelling to Canada.
To Apply for a student visa, you need:
- an attestation letter to apply for a study permit.
As of January 22, 2024, most students must provide an attestation letter from the province or territory where they intend to study with their study permit application. - If you apply without an attestation letter, your application will be returned, unless you are
